About The Position

Catalyx Services, LLC seeks a Validation Engineer reporting to office in Montgomeryville, PA to prepare various control systems validation documents, including user requirement specifications, functional requirements specifications, and detailed design specifications. Prepare and execute validation protocols and installation qualification protocols. Configure, program, test, and troubleshoot PLC. Configure, validate, design, and test DCS. Work on a variety of programmable logic controller systems and a variety of Distributed Controls Systems (DCS). Configure, validate, and test the Human Machine Interface (HMI) systems with the control systems. Design, program, test, validate, and maintain process controls and automation systems, including selecting the control system. Provide technical specifications for the control system, such as hardware and software specifications. Select the networking interface required to connect the control system to the process to be controlled, handling multiple projects concurrently.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ering, Electronic Engineering, or a foreign equivalent.
  • At least three (3) years of experience as an Automation Engineer or a substantially similar position performing all the duties as listed above.
